Cleveland vs St. Louis Game Final 7-2 - Zach Plesac Earns Win

Franmil Reyes swatted 2 round trippers and drove in 2 runs as his Indians defeated St. Louis 7-2 at Progressive Field.

Cleveland was an underdog by +100 and came through for bettors backing them. The game went OVER the consensus closing total of 8.5.

Cleveland got 1 innings from Blake Parker, who gave up 0 earned runs on 0 hits, while striking out 2. Zach Plesac earned the victory, while the Indians got 3 RBIs from Cesar Hernandez in the win.

St. Louis's starting pitcher Andrew Miller worked 1 innings, giving up 0 hits and 0 earned runs while striking out 2 in the loss. They got 2 hits from Dylan Carlson in a losing cause.

Cleveland outhit their counterparts 9-7 in the game.

Next game, Cleveland takes its act on the road to face Chicago looking for another win. For St. Louis, they head home to face Minnesota.
